The opportunity
We are looking for a Project Manager for Secondary Engineering to join our team. In this role, you will manage secondary engineering projects (LCC local control cabinets) from handover from sales until the end of installation, including engineering and production in collaboration with primary engineering and under the leadership of the Commercial Project Manager of the GIS Project.
How you’ll make an impact
Lead secondary engineering projects from handover from sales, clarification of specifications, and full project management scope (scope, time, cost)
Coordinate with the Commercial Project Manager on time, scope, and cost
Lead engineering activities with the extended workbench (base design and detail design)
Detect deviations and claims, clarify with customers, and conduct customer meetings
Achieve design freeze and customer approval, create production documents, and support production in feeder factories or supplier factories
Conduct final acceptance tests with customers, support site installation and commissioning, and create as-built documents for project close-out
Actively participate in project reporting structures such as the digital project board
Assist with sales and tender processes. Provide support to the production line
Contribute to development projects and improvement initiatives
